Popup window not popping up

I'm trying to have a popup window of new changes when a person comes to my
web page and something has changed. I can see the "alert" popping up, but
not the page. The page would look better and wouldn't stop the original
page from opening until it was closed. Here is my code:

<body bgcolor="lightgoldenrodyellow" onload="initindex();">

<div id="flyingimage1" style="position:absolute; left:0px; top:150px;
z-index:0;">
<img src="../images/DT0504_32tn.jpg" border="0"></div>

<div id="flyingimage2" style="position:absolute; left:0px; top:450px;
z-index:0;">
<img src="../images/DT0504_33tn.jpg" border="0"></div>

<script language="JavaScript">
alert("AITTC has an updated web page on May 29, 2005 at 10:12 AM\n\nGo to
News to see the changes.");
var popup = window.open("http://www.mokenamartialarts.com/tkdupdate.html",
"TKD Updated", "width=200,height=250,status=no");
</script>

Take the space out of the window name:
var popup = window.open(
"http://www.mokenamartialarts.com/tkdupdate.html",
"TKDUpdated", "width=200,height=250,status=no");

Jul 23 '05 #2
Thank you, that was it. I would have never guessed that as I was confused
and thought the name parameter was the title of the page which can have
spaces. Duh.

In addition to the problem with the space in the window name that has
already been pointed out, I will never see that popup window no matter
what you change in the code unless you make it user initiated due to my
popup blocker not accepting your unsolicited popup window.
